Define capacitor reactance. Write its S.I units.

उत्तर
Capacitor reactance is the resistance offered by a capacitor when it is connected to an electric circuit. It is given by
`X_C=1/(omegaC)`
where
ω = Angular frequency of the source
C = Capacitance of the capacitor
The SI unit of capacitor reactance is ohm (Ω).
